Whiskey: The Rich History and Selections

Whiskey, a spirit soaked in tradition, flaunts a rich background that spans centuries and continents. Coming from old Mesopotamia, its journey developed via Ireland and Scotland, where it obtained a reputation for workmanship. The manufacturing procedure, involving fermentation, distillation, and aging in wooden barrels, adds to its distinctive personality.

There are a number of ranges of scotch, each with one-of-a-kind characteristics. Scotch whisky is known for its great smoky flavor, usually influenced by peat. Irish whiskey tends to be smoother, typically triple-distilled, while bourbon, mainly produced in the United States, is sweeter as a result of its corn base. Rye whiskey uses a spicier profile, highlighting the grain's distinct top qualities.

These varied types show local customs and preferences, creating a vast landscape for scotch fanatics. With each sip, one can taste the background and virtuosity ingrained in this precious spirit, making it a cherished selection worldwide.

Rum: A Pleasant Journey With Tropical Tastes

Rum, a spirit with a rich tapestry of tastes, is crafted largely from sugarcane by-products like molasses or directly from sugarcane juice. This functional liquor can be categorized right into a number of types, including light, dark, and spiced rums, each offering distinctive characteristics. Twin Liquor. Light rum, commonly clear and slightly flavored, is ideal for mixed drinks, while dark rum flaunts a much deeper, richer profile, perfect for sipping or in robust beverages. Spiced rum, instilled with various seasonings and flavors, adds an interesting spin to typical recipes

Originating from the Caribbean, rum mirrors its tropical origins through notes of vanilla, coconut, and tropical fruits. Its production process varies by region, influencing the final preference and aroma. The aging procedure in wooden barrels better improves rum's complexity, resulting in a smooth finish that interest both laid-back enthusiasts and connoisseurs alike. Inevitably, rum personifies a wonderful trip via diverse and tempting tastes, commemorating its cultural heritage.

Kinds of Tequila

Although often connected with lively feasts and sun-soaked beaches, the significance of tequila hinges on its varied types, each showcasing distinct attributes and flavors. The key groups include Blanco, which is unaged and offers a pure agave flavor; Reposado, aged for a minimum of two months to one year, using a smooth, well balanced taste; and Añejo, aged for at the very least one year, providing a richer, extra intricate profile due to its time in oak barrels. There is additionally Extra Añejo, aged for over three years, boasting deep, elaborate tastes - Liquor Store near me. Lastly, the restricted edition, commonly referred to as "Cristalino," is a filtered Añejo or Bonus Añejo, removing the color while maintaining the deepness of flavor. Each type invites exploration and admiration

Production Process Explained

The journey of tequila from agave plant to container is a precise procedure that shows custom and craftsmanship. It starts with the harvesting of the blue agave plant, which commonly takes seven to ten years to mature. Knowledgeable jimadores very carefully cut the plant's heart, or piña, eliminating its spiky leaves. The piñas are after that steamed in ovens or prepared in autoclaves, which converts the starches right into fermentable sugars. After cooling, the pulp is squashed to extract the juice, which is fermented making use of all-natural or grown yeast. The resulting liquid is distilled, typically twice, to accomplish the desired purity and flavor account. Ultimately, tequila is aged in barrels for differing durations, improving its personality before bottling.

Sampling Notes and Pairings

A charming spirit, tequila uses a complicated selection of flavors and scents that can vary significantly based on its type and aging process. Blanco tequila presents a lively account with notes of citrus and pepper, while Reposado discloses deeper layers of vanilla and oak from its time in barrels. Añejo, aged much longer, introduces abundant caramel and chocolate undertones, showcasing its polished personality.

When it pertains to pairings, Blanco is suitable for fresh ceviche or spicy tacos, boosting the zest of the dish. Reposado matches smoked meats and rich mole sauces, including depth to the flavors. Añejo stands beautifully on its very own or with dark delicious chocolate, inviting an extravagant sampling experience. Each kind invites exploration, commemorating the spirit of Mexico.

Beginnings and Production Process

Originating from Eastern Europe, vodka has a rich history linked with different cultural traditions. The spirit is believed to go back to the 8th or 9th century, with roots in Russia and Poland. Typically, vodka is produced via the fermentation of grains or potatoes, which are after that distilled to accomplish a high alcohol content. The distillation process often includes several rounds to ensure purity and level of smoothness. After purification, the spirit is generally filteringed system, sometimes via charcoal, to enhance its clearness. Water is then included to get to the desired alcohol degree, usually around 40% ABV. This thorough manufacturing process adds to vodka's online reputation as a versatile and neutral spirit, making it a popular choice for alcoholic drinks and cocktails.

Popular Cocktails Utilizing Vodka

The legendary nature of vodka radiates with in a myriad of preferred mixed drinks that display its flexibility. Popular for its neutral flavor, vodka serves as the base for classic drinks such as the Vodka Martini, where it is elegantly coupled with dry vermouth. The Moscow Burro, a renewing mix of vodka, ginger beer, and lime juice, highlights its flexibility. In addition, the Bloody Mary, a mouthwatering concoction featuring vodka, tomato juice, and a range of seasonings, attract those looking for a strong taste profile. For a lighter choice, the Cosmopolitan integrates vodka with three-way sec and cranberry juice, developing a vivid cocktail. Each of these drinks exemplifies vodka's capability to balance with diverse components, making it a favored amongst mixologists and cocktail fanatics alike.

Gin: Botanical Infusions and Revitalizing Profiles



Although gin has a long-standing track record as a classic spirit, its attraction exists in the diverse variety of herb mixtures that define its character. At the heart of a lot of gins is juniper, which imparts a distinctive piney flavor. Nevertheless, distillers often explore a range of botanicals, including coriander, citrus peels, angelica origin, and various natural herbs and spices, leading to distinct taste profiles.

These mixtures add to gin's convenience, making it appropriate for a variety of alcoholic drinks or enjoyed neat. Some gins emphasize flower notes, while others concentrate on citrus or earthiness, attracting a variety of tastes buds. The invigorating nature of gin typically makes it a favored option for summer beverages, such as the classic gin and restorative. With its complicated yet friendly flavor, gin remains to astound lovers and newcomers alike, strengthening its place worldwide of spirits.

Brandy: The Beauty of Distilled Wine

While lots of spirits are celebrated for their vibrant flavors, brandy attracts attention as a refined experience rooted in the art of distilling red wine. This sophisticated liquor, normally created from fermented fruit juice, commonly includes grapes, although various other fruits can additionally be utilized. The distillation procedure concentrates the tastes, resulting in a smooth and complex spirit that showcases the attributes of its resource material.

Brandy is frequently aged in wood barrels, which gives extra deepness and complexity, allowing notes of vanilla, flavor, and caramel to create. Its alcohol material usually varies from 35% to 60%, making it a powerful yet advanced selection. Delighted in cool, in mixed drinks, or as a digestif, brandy interest a variety of tastes. Liqueurs: Sweetened Spirits With a Spin

Liqueurs, usually identified by their pleasant and vibrant flavors, represent a special group within the world of spirits (Liquor Store). These beverages are normally made by instilling a base spirit with various flavorings, consisting of fruits, natural herbs, seasonings, and other botanicals. The sweetness of liqueurs normally originates from added sugar or syrup, which stabilizes the alcohol material, making them much more tasty for numerous customers

Liqueurs can be classified into numerous kinds, such as fruit liqueurs, lotion liqueurs, and organic liqueurs, each offering unique flavor profiles. Popular examples consist of Grand Marnier, Amaretto, and Baileys Irish Lotion.

Frequently appreciated in mixed drinks or as digestifs, liqueurs include intricacy and splendor to beverages. Their versatility reaches culinary usages also, improving treats and sauces. Overall, liqueurs personify a fascinating fusion of imagination and custom, attracting a wide variety of tastes and choices.
